| Thaiphoon wrote: | Here's the deal. The entire time Danny has owned the team he has not had to think about hosting a playoff game in January. Hence why he lets so many late season concerts/college games, etc... on the field. Its also why we haven't re-sodded the field after October. Because come January, no one has been playing on it.
This was a rude awakening for him.
So if he's smart, he'll re-sod the field at the end of October/beginning of November and cut out anything but Redskins games on the field after Thanksgiving. |
